Abstract

The present invention relates to a kind of efficiently load equipment, including transfer carriage, material dolly, the material dolly first driving means moved on the transfer carriage and the second driving means for driving the transfer carriage movement are driven, one end of the stroke of the transfer carriage is provided with charging manipulator.The elevating mechanism that the charging manipulator is included support board and is connected with the support board, rotating mechanism is provided with below the elevating mechanism, the rotating mechanism includes that base and the rotating part on the base, the elevating mechanism are connected with the rotating part.First level travel mechanism is additionally provided with below the base, and the first level travel mechanism includes that first level motion portion and first level fixed part, the first level motion portion are connected with the base.The charging appliance of this structure has higher efficiency of loading.

Background technology
It is important one procedure in industrialized production that material is loaded, and how efficiently and stably material to be loaded always It is the problem for needing constantly to be studied and be persistently improved optimization.Present material is loaded to be substantially all to employ and is provided with The multi-spindle machining handss of vacuum cup or gas pawl.One product once can only typically be picked up using the equipment of this structure, this Efficiency of loading can be caused relatively low, when the charging appliance of this structure is arranged on automatic production line, if after charging appliance The processing effect of the processing stations at end is not that very high, current this charging appliance can on the contrary substantially meet use demand, but When the working (machining) efficiency of the processing stations of charging appliance rear end is higher, the charging appliance of this structure cannot meet requirement If being also to continue with the charging appliance using this structure, subsequent process station will be produced and dallied situation to be expected.Simultaneously The structure of current charging appliance is more single, the mechanism not complemented one another, it is impossible to enough adapt to the higher production of automatic degree Line, so occur that charging appliance restricts the problem of whole automatic production line production efficiency.In lithium battery processing, it is often necessary to Being transported through to lithium cells, current lithium cells mostly are laminated structure to spent material dolly, using traditional dress Load equipment come load lithium cells can because the automaticity for loading is not high the situation that cause efficiency of loading not high, now Need a kind of higher charging appliance of efficiency of loading badly.

Specific embodiment
As shown in Figure 1, 2, a kind of efficiently loading is equipped, and including transfer carriage 90, material dolly 80, drives the material dolly 80 first driving means 10 moved on the transfer carriage 90 and the second driving means of the driving movement of transfer carriage 90 20, one end of the stroke of the transfer carriage 90 is provided with charging manipulator 30.The first driving means 10 include being arranged on First tooth bar 11 of 80 bottom of material dolly and it is arranged on the transfer carriage 90 and coordinates with first tooth bar 11 First gear 12, the first gear 12 driven by the first motor 13.Second driving means 20 include being arranged on Second tooth bar 21 of 90 bottom of the transfer carriage and it is arranged on below the transfer carriage 90 and matches somebody with somebody with second tooth bar 21 The second gear 22 of conjunction, the second gear 22 are driven by the second motor 23.The end face of the first gear 12 with described The end face of second gear 22 is vertical, and the first driving means 10 also include the first guiding mechanism 14, first guiding mechanism 14 include the guided way 141 being arranged on the transfer carriage 90 and be arranged on the material dolly 80 and with the guided way 141 directive wheels 142 for coordinating.The material dolly 80 includes the horizontal supports 81 being connected with each other and vertical supporter 82, L-shaped supporter 83 is provided with the sustained height of two relative vertical supporters 82, on the L-shaped supporter 83 It is provided with several the second barriers 84.
As shown in figure 3, the elevator that the charging manipulator 30 is included support board 31 and is connected with the support board 31 Structure 32, is provided with rotating mechanism 33 in the lower section of the elevating mechanism 32, and the rotating mechanism 33 includes base 331 and installs Rotating part 332 on the base 331, the elevating mechanism 32 are connected with the rotating part 332.In the base 331 Lower section is additionally provided with first level travel mechanism 34, the first level travel mechanism 34 include first level motion portion 341 with And first level fixed part 342, the first level motion portion 341 is connected with the base 331.Also include being arranged on described The second horizontal mobile mechanism 35 below one horizontal mobile mechanism 34, second horizontal mobile mechanism 35 include that the second level is transported Dynamic portion 351 and the second horizontal fixed part 352, the first level fixed part 342 are connected with the second horizontal movement portion 351 Connect.The direction of motion in the first level motion portion 341 is vertical with the direction of motion in the second horizontal movement portion 351.Described Some first barriers 311 are provided with support board 31.
